### Account Recovery — Catalogue Import (Lintwood)

Quick one for review: when the Lintwood catalogue import wipes a patron's session table, the recovery flow re-seeds accounts from the nightly snapshot. Check that the importer skips locked accounts — last time it didn't. To rerun recovery against staging you'll need the vault passphrase, which is appended just below.

recovery phrase for yafof-tajof: julmir-kelax-julvan-holath-belvan-holir-ralael-ralvan-ralath-julvan-silmir-istmir-kaswyn-ulamir

### Changelog — v2.9.1 (Glyphsense)

Rotated the signing key after the encoding-detection overhaul. We swapped the old heuristic sniffer for a confidence-scored detector, so uploaded text files with BOM-less UTF-16 no longer get mangled into mojibake. Also fixed the fallback that assumed Latin-1 way too eagerly. Reviewers: the detection module is now its own crate, so diff noise is mostly moves. All release artifacts from this version onward are signed with the new key shown here.

release key, fahaf-bajof: bky3_Xam

Welcome aboard! You'll be working on Pedalflow, our rebalancing tool that figures out which docks in the Harlow Bay network are about to overflow or run dry. Most of your work happens in the dispatch-planner repo, but the optimizer talks to the Stationgraph service for live dock counts. Quick heads-up: the staging optimizer runs every 20 minutes, so don't panic if your changes take a bit to show up. To query Stationgraph from your dev box, use the key below.

gateway credential: kto23_LX9A4ys6i4nzHtpOLNLodKK